Bueno ya tengo acabada la primera versión del juego koday tetris. Para todos aquellos que quiera probarlo les dejo el link de descarga. Espero que les guste.
utilizo el comando textout_ex. Su descripcion es el siguiente : void textout_ex(BITMAP *bmp, const FONT *f, const char *s, int x, int y, int color, int bg);
para pasar un int a char, utiliza itoa(variablenum,cadena1,10); pasa el valor int de variablenum al char cadena1.
hola.....que bueno...el juego,,...:D miren..acabo.....de conocer....allegro..en dev c++ ...y tengo un problemita.....
como puedo hacer para hacer que dos...imagenes..choquen? un ejemplo: con pacman;
BITMAP *pacman; //cargo una imagen de 32x32 BITMAP *enemigo; //cargo una imagen de 32x32
int x,y; //coordenadas de pacman int ex,ey; //coordenadas de enemigo
como hago que los dos choquen??
yo uso
if(x==ex && y==ey)
pero solo me sirve...en un cierto punto...de bitmap.......... no me funciona cuando choca una parte del cuerpo........ como soluciono este problema??:P
por faboy ayudenme..de anteman...GRACIAS........KODAY y felicidades por ese gran juego :D
ha,....y una preguntita........que tb.....choque con un problema....por que hay algunos archivos...BMP......que al cargarlo e imprimirlo en mi programa...me salen con el fondo blanco...:S.....por fa ayuda..:D
Muy buena version de Tetris !
ResponderEliminarUna pregunta, como le haces para ir imprimiendo una variable en pantalla con Allegro???
ResponderEliminarutilizo el comando textout_ex. Su descripcion es el siguiente :
Eliminarvoid textout_ex(BITMAP *bmp, const FONT *f, const char *s, int x, int y, int color, int bg);
para pasar un int a char, utiliza itoa(variablenum,cadena1,10); pasa el valor int de variablenum al char cadena1.
hola.....que bueno...el juego,,...:D miren..acabo.....de conocer....allegro..en dev c++ ...y tengo un problemita.....
ResponderEliminarcomo puedo hacer para hacer que dos...imagenes..choquen? un ejemplo:
con pacman;
BITMAP *pacman; //cargo una imagen de 32x32
BITMAP *enemigo; //cargo una imagen de 32x32
int x,y; //coordenadas de pacman
int ex,ey; //coordenadas de enemigo
como hago que los dos choquen??
yo uso
if(x==ex && y==ey)
pero solo me sirve...en un cierto punto...de bitmap..........
no me funciona cuando choca una parte del cuerpo........
como soluciono este problema??:P
por faboy ayudenme..de anteman...GRACIAS........KODAY
y felicidades por ese gran juego :D
hola, tengo un ejemplo que quizas te pueda valer.
Eliminarhttp://devcpp-allegro.blogspot.com.es/2012/06/pompa.html
si tienes alguna duda es mejor que lo plantees en el foro:
http://creatusjuegosdecero.webege.com/index.php
checa este video: http://www.youtube.com/watch?v=5EU-qoFS70o
Eliminarha,....y una preguntita........que tb.....choque con un problema....por que hay algunos archivos...BMP......que al cargarlo e imprimirlo en mi programa...me salen con el fondo blanco...:S.....por fa ayuda..:D
ResponderEliminar